Call for Participation

VIRTUAL EVENTS IN THE METAVERSE
A co-production of LA ACM SIGGRAPH and the Producers Guild of America’s New Media Council
Tuesday, April 13, 2021, 6:30 PM (PDT)
Online (Zoom)
https://lasiggraph.org/event/virtual-events-metaverse

DESCRIPTION:

This panel introduces producers, developers and digital artists to the new world of online events using real-time 3D massively multiplayer online virtual worlds (loosely referred to as “the metaverse”). Panelists will introduce platforms, present case studies and discuss current day challenges and future directions. The panel will be moderated by Chapter Past Chair and PGA New Media Council board delegate Ed Lantz.
